From c5f01e9a882b16f534166d033312c5c8ba8d94dd Mon Sep 17 00:00:00 2001
From: xiaojiao <xiaojiao@kaokeziliao.com>
Date: 星期六, 24 一月 2026 14:35:21 +0800
Subject: [PATCH] 离开北京前最后的版本,包含打印机程序

---
 项目代码/WCS/WIDESEA_WCSServer/WIDESEA_Services/Services/Common/FinishedRgvTask.cs |   14 +++++++++++---
 1 files changed, 11 insertions(+), 3 deletions(-)

diff --git "a/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EA_WCSServer/WIDESEA_Services/Services/Common/FinishedRgvTask.cs" "b/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EA_WCSServer/WIDESEA_Services/Services/Common/FinishedRgvTask.cs"
index eb68833..ab9429a 100644
--- "a/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EA_WCSServer/WIDESEA_Services/Services/Common/FinishedRgvTask.cs"
+++ "b/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EA_WCSServer/WIDESEA_Services/Services/Common/FinishedRgvTask.cs"
@@ -1,13 +1,11 @@
 锘縰sing System;
-using System.Collections.Generic;
-using System.Text;
 using WIDESEA_Common;
 using WIDESEA_Common.TaskEnum;
 using WIDESEA_Core.Utilities;
 using WIDESEA_Entity.DomainModels;
 using WIDESEA_Services.IRepositories;
 using WIDESEA_Services.Repositories;
-
+using WIDESEA_WCS;
 namespace WIDESEA_Services.Services
 {
     public partial class CommonFunction
@@ -98,6 +96,16 @@
                             else if (taskWCSinfo.wcstask_type == TaskType.TaskType_Box_Pallet_Outbound.ToString())
                                 //state = TaskState.TaskState_Box_Out_Line_Executing.ToString();
                                 state = TaskState.TaskState_Box_Out_RGV_Finished.ToString();    //锛�2525-12-12淇敼锛変慨鏀规垚鎻愬崌鏈鸿繍琛屼腑
+
+                            //PLCClient client = WCSService.Clients.Find(r => r.PLCName == "LineDevice");
+                            // 杩欎釜鍦版柟瑕佸線瀵瑰簲鐨勫嚭搴撶珯鍙板啓浠诲姟鍙峰拰鎵樼洏鍙�
+                            //PLCClient client = WCSService.Clients.Find(r => r.PLCName == "LineDevice");
+                            //鍐欏叆鎵樼洏鏉$爜
+
+                            //PLCClient client = WCSService.Clients.Find(r => r.PLCName == "LineDevice");
+                            //bool writeTaskNumber = client.WriteValue(CLineInfoDBName.W_Line_TaskNumber.ToString(), taskWCSinfo.wcstask_startPoint, taskWCSinfo.wcstask_taskNumber);
+                            //bool writeBarcode = client.WriteValue(CLineInfoDBName.W_Line_Barcode.ToString(), taskWCSinfo.wcstask_startPoint, taskWCSinfo.wcstask_barcode);
+                           
                         }
                         else
                             state = TaskState.TaskState_RGV_Finished.ToString();

--
Gitblit v1.9.3